Restaurants In Haryana Can Now Stay Open 24x7

Restaurants in Haryana will be allowed to operate round-the-clock, Deputy Chief Minister Dushyant Chautala said on Tuesday.


"In future, restaurants will remain open 24 hours in Haryana. There will be no restriction on them to close at night,” Chautala said in the statement.

6 Dead As Auto-Rickshaw Collides With Car In Agra

Six people lost their lives when an auto-rickshaw collided with a speeding car here, police said on Tuesday. The incident took place around 10.30 pm on Monday in the Kheragarh police station area, they said.


Deputy Commissioner of Police (West) Sonam Kumar said two people died on the spot after the crash and four more succumbed to injuries during treatment at a hospital in Agra, as reported by PTI. The deceased were identified as Jayprakash, Sumit, Brajesh Devi, Brajmohan Sharma, Manoj Sharma and auto-rickshaw driver Bhola.


Kheragarh police station in-charge Rajeev Kumar said the person driving the car is at large but his two friends, Pinku and Baniya, have been arrested. Kumar said car driver Bunty was likely under the influence of alcohol and the accident took place when he was returning home after dropping his friends off.

2 Farmers Shot Dead In UP Village

Two farmers were shot dead by assailants in a village here, police said on Tuesday. The incident occurred on Monday night when the victims were working on their agricultural land in Marui Krishnadaspur village under the Akhand Nagar police station area, they said.


Superintendent of Police Somen Burma identified the deceased as Dharmraj Maurya (60) and Vijay Kumar Rajbhar (45) and said it appeared to be a case of old enmity that led to the killing, as reported by PTI. The farmers were rushed to a community health centre after the shooting where doctors declared them dead, police said.


No arrests have so far been made in this connection, Burma added.

Man Dies After Being Thrashed In Delhi's Wazirabad, 1 Held: Police

A 43-year-old man died after he was allegedly beaten up by another man in north Delhi's Wazirabad area, police said on Tuesday. Accused Manoj (35), a resident of Sant Nagar, has been arrested, they said, adding that he was previously involved in five criminal cases.


A PCR call was received at the Wazirabad police station regarding a quarrel. On reaching the spot, police found Parvinder, a resident of Sant Nagar, Burari, in an injured condition and rushed him to a hospital, where he died during treatment, Deputy Commissioner of Police (North) Sagar Singh Kalsi said, as reported by PTI.


The body has been shifted to a mortuary. The statement of eyewitness Girish Babu has been recorded where he has said Parvinder was mercilessly thrashed by Manoj with a stick, the DCP informed.


A preliminary probe has revealed that the quarrel broke out between the deceased and the accused after they brushed past each other while walking on a road. Following a verbal spat during which the deceased abused the accused, the latter allegedly caught hold of a wooden plank and hit the former.

Supreme Court To Hear AAP Plea Challenging Centre's Ordinance On Delhi Services Tomorrow


A Supreme Court bench, headed by Chief Justice of India DY Chandrachud, will hear the AAP government's petition on Tuesday challenging the constitutionality of the Centre's ordinance on control of services in Delhi.


Last week, the Arvind Kejriwal-led AAP government approached the Supreme Court over the Centre's ordinance that reversed the effect of Supreme Court verdict in May that gave the local government power over administrative services.


In its petition, the Delhi government stated that the Centre's ordinance was "unconstitutional and it should be immediately put on hold".


The plea submitted that the ordinance wrested control over civil servants serving in the Government of NCT of Delhi (GNCTD) from the Delhi government to the "un-elected" Lt Governor "without seeking to amend the Constitution, in particular Article 239AA" that gives control over services to the elected dispensation.


Besides, the Kejriwal government has also challenged the validity of Section 45D of the ordinance, which gives the Centre control over statutory bodies, commissions, boards and authorities with the power to appoint their members through the President.


PM Modi To Inaugurate Sai Hira Global Convention In Andhra Pradesh


Prime Minister Narendra Modi will inaugurate the Sai Hira Global Convention Centre at Puttaparthi in Andhra Pradesh on July 4 via video conference. The Prime Minister's Office (PMO) said the inauguration ceremony will witness the presence of prominent dignitaries and devotees from around the world.


The Sri Sathya Sai Central Trust has constructed a new facility, Sai Hira Global Convention Centre, at its main ashram in Prasanthi Nilayam. The Convention Centre, donated by philanthropist Shri Ryuko Hira, is a testament to the vision of promoting cultural exchange, spirituality, and global harmony, it said.
